B-SC in Chemistry at Government Women's College, Gulzarbagh, Patna

Government Women's College, Patna is a premier constituent women's institution located in Patna, Bihar. Established in 1951 and affiliated with Patliputra University, it offers diverse undergraduate and postgraduate programs. Recognized with NAAC B Grade, it fosters a strong academic environment for female students.

About the Specialization

What is Chemistry at Government Women's College, Gulzarbagh, Patna Patna?

This Chemistry program at Government Women''''s College, Patna, focuses on a comprehensive understanding of chemical principles and their applications, aligning with the NEP-2020 framework. It aims to develop analytical and problem-solving skills crucial for various Indian industries including pharmaceuticals, agriculture, and manufacturing, fostering a strong foundation in both theoretical and practical aspects of chemistry.

Who Should Apply?

This program is ideal for 10+2 science graduates with a keen interest in fundamental chemical sciences, laboratory work, and research. It''''s suitable for students aspiring to work in chemical industries, pursue higher studies like M.Sc/Ph.D, or prepare for competitive exams in India, providing a solid academic base for future specialization.

Why Choose This Course?

Graduates of this program can expect diverse career paths in India, including roles as Quality Control Chemists, Research Assistants, Lab Analysts, or educators. Entry-level salaries typically range from INR 2.5-4 LPA, with experienced professionals earning INR 6-10 LPA. The curriculum prepares students for opportunities in sectors like petrochemicals, agrochemicals, and environmental analysis.

Program Structure and Curriculum

Eligibility:

  • 10+2 with Science stream (as per Patliputra University norms for B.Sc programs)

Duration: 3 years / 6 semesters

Credits: 144 Credits

Assessment: Internal: 30% (Continuous Internal Assessment - CIA), External: 70% (End Semester Examination - ESE)
